10 arrested for attacking Lagos task force officials, 96 motorcycles seized

Ten persons have been arrested for attacking the men of Lagos State Taskforce on Environmental and Sanitation (Enforcement) Unit during an enforcement of the state’s traffic laws on Tuesday.

The suspects were reportedly arrested during the commotion that broke out in Ojodu and Obanikoro areas while the task force men were carrying out the enforcement in different areas of the state.

A statement on Tuesday added that no fewer than 96 commercial motorcycles operating on highways and other restricted routes were impounded, adding that four motorists driving against the traffic were arrested.

“Some hoodlums teamed up with motorcycle riders around Ojodu Grammar School to resist the move by the task force to take away the motorcycles seized during the enforcement.

“As the hoodlums, armed with iron rods and broken bottles, approached, the policemen, led by the task force chairman, SP Shola Jejeloye, repelled the attack.

“Also at Obanikoro, the motorcycle riders, on sighting the enforcement team, pelted the task force officers with stones. The policemen arrested four persons. One person was arrested in Ojota,” the statement reads partly.
